.mainhead {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 32px;
	font-weight: bold;
	color: #D6D6D6;
}
.bg01 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#616161;
	background-color: #FCF1E4;
}
.bg02 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#616161;
	background-color: #FCF1E4;
}
input {
	font-family: Tahoma, Arial, Verdana;
	font-size: 12px;
	color: #616161;
	border: 1px solid #BCBCBC;
}
input.but {
	font-family: Tahoma, Arial, Verdana;
	font-size: 12px;
	color: #8C3B25;
	border: 1px solid #BAB3AB;
	font-weight: bold;
	background-color: #FCF1E4;
	cursor:hand;
	text-decoration:none 

}
a.index: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#616161;
	text-decoration:none
}
a.index: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#616161;
	text-decoration:none	
}
a.index: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#FF0000;
	text-decoration:none}
a.index:active {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: bold;
	color: #0000FF;
	text-decoration:none
}
.errormsg {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FF0000;
}
.gen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#3c3c3c;
}
.gen01 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#3c3c3c;
}
.gen02 {
	font-family: Tahoma, Arial, Verdana;
	font-size: 12px;
	font-weight: bold;
	color: #3c3c3c;
}
.bg03 {
	font-family: Tahoma, Arial, Verdana;
	font-size: 12px;
	font-weight: bold;
	color: #3c3c3c;
	background-color: #FCF1E4;
}
.head {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 22px;
	font-weight: bold;
	color: #CCC9C9;
}
.bg04 {
	background-color: #EF0F07;
}
.head01 {
	font-family: Tahoma, Arial, Verdana;
	font-size: 18px;
	font-weight: bold;
	color: #535353;
}
.head02 {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: bold;
	color: #857255;
	background-color: #F9E4CC;
}
.head03 {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: bold;
	color: #876841;
	background-color: #FECC9C;
}
select {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#616161;
	border: 1px solid #bcbcbc;
}
.bg05 {
	background-color: #F5EEE7;
}
.footer {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 10px;
	color: #A9A9A9;
}
a.footer:link {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 10px;
	color: #a9a9a9;
}
a.footer:visited {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 10px;
	color: #a9a9a9;
}
a.footer:hover {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 10px;
	color: #FF0000;
}
a.footer:active {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 10px;
	color: #0000FF;
}
a.header:link {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: bold;
	color: #857255;
}
a.header:visited {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: bold;
	color: #857255;
}
a.header:hover {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: bold;
	color: #ff0000;
}
a.header:active {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	color: #0000ff;
}
.gen03 {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	color: #82735F;
}
.gen04 {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	color: #82735F;
	background-color: #F0E7E7;
}
.head04 {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 12px;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#BE9393;
}
.head05 {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	font-weight: bold;
	color: #949494;
}
.gen05 {
	font-family: "Trebuchet MS", Arial, Verdana;
	font-size: 11px;
	color: #949494;
}
textarea {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#616161;
	border: 1px solid #bcbcbc;
}
.Message_bold 
{  
	font-family: "Trebuchet MS", Arial, Verdana;
	font-weight: bold;
	font-size: 15px;
	color: #82735F;
}
